There is a lot of talk out there about “Fractional Laser Resurfacing”.
Here is some information to help clarify what that means and why the public is so excited about this treatment.

For those of us not ready for surgical procedures….Fractional laser resurfacing can provide the next best thing. This technology allows fractionated light from the laser to go beneath the skin surface to heat the dermal layer and initiate the stimulation of collagen through the body’s own ability to heal. Because the light is “fractionated” some of the skin stays in tact so the healing process is shortened.

Fractional CO2 laser resurfacing repairs enlarged pores,acne scars and improves the texture and tone of the skin. The procedure requires approximately one week of minimal down time. This down time varies depending on the intensity of the energy level selected. You get to determine what setting you would like used. The post healing process is more visible than it is painful. Typically, the first day it feels like a bad sunburn, some swelling may occur depending on the intensity level chosen. The sunburn look turns to a dark brown stage followed by peeling that begins on about day three.

The fun part is when your new, blemish free skin becomes visible. The hardest part is to be patient while the collagen building process
occurs. Improvements will continue over 3-6 months. Your body needs time to build up the new, stronger collagen level in your skin. It is not instantaneous but don’t worry your friends will notice the dullness removed, the youthful glow and the toning and tightening that continues to improve in the months to come!
